浅谈数据库技术与数据仓库
时间:2025-02-26
时间:2025-02-26
数据仓库是数据库技术的一个新的发展方向,它是一种交叉学科的开放式体系结构,是一种由多种技术构成的灵活的数据分析型环境。如何正确理解数据库技术与数据仓库对系统开发领域起到了至关重要的作用。
科技信息
计算机与网络
浅谈数据库技市与数据仓库湖南水利水电职业技术学院学院吴振国[摘要]数据仓库是数据库技术的一个新的发展方向,它是一种交叉学科的开放式体系结构,一种由多种技术构成的灵活的数据是分析型环境。如何正确理解数据库技术与数据仓库对系统开发领域起到了至关重要的作用。 [关键词]数据库技术数据仓库一
、
数据技术发展概述
在数据库出现前,计算机用户是使用数据文件来存放数据的。常用的高级语言从早期的 F R R N到今天的 c语言,都支持使用数据文 O TA件。有一种常见的数据文件的格式是,一个文件包含若干个“记录”一,个记录又包含若干个“数据项”用户通过对文件的访问实现对记录的,存取。通常称支持这种数据管理方式的软件为“文件管理系统”在这种。管理方式下,这些数据与其他文件中数据有大量的重复,造成了资源与人力的浪费。随着计算机所处理的数据的日益增多,数据重复的问题越来越突出。于是人们就想到将数据集中存储、统一管理,这样就演变成数据库管理系统从而形成数据库技术。 数据库的诞生以 2世纪 6年代 I M公司推出的数据库管理产品 O 0 B I ( fr t n ngmet ytm为标志。数据库的出现, MSI omao Maae n s】 n i S e实现了数据资源的整体和结构化管理,使数据具有了共享性和一定的独立性,并能够对冗余度进行控制。数据库管理系统的推出,使得数据库概念得到了 普及,也使得人们认识到数据的价值和统一管理的必要。但是由于 I MS是以层次模型来组织和管理数据的,对非层次数据使用虚拟记录,大量指针的使用降低了数据使用的效率,同时,数据库管理系统提供的数据模型机及数据库语言比较低级,数据的独立性也比较差,给使用带来了很大的局限性。为了克服这些缺点,国数据库系统语言 ̄ (O AS L美 CD Y,即 C ne neO a yt a gae下属的数据库任务组 ( T即 o fe c nD t S s mL nug) f a e DB G, D t ae akGo p对数据库的方法和技术进行了系统研究,提出了 a B sTs ru) a并著名的 D T B G报告。该报告确定并建立了数据库系统的许多基本概念、 方法和技术,报告成为网状数据模型
的典型技术代表,它奠定了数据库发展的基础,并影响着以后的研究。网状模型是基于图来组织数据的, 对数据的访问和操纵需要遍历数据链来完成。因这种有效的实现方式对系统使用者提出了很高的要求,所以阻碍了系统的推广应用。 17 9 0年 I M公司的 E..o d发表了著名的基于关系模型的数据 B FC d库技术的论文《大型共享数据库数据的关系模型》并获得 18年 A M, 91 C 图灵奖,标志着关系模型数据库模型的诞生。由于关系模型的简单易理解及其所具有的坚实理论基础,整个 2世纪 7年代和 8年代的前半 0 0 0期,数据库界集中围绕关系数据库进行了大量的研究和开发工作,对关系数据库概念的实用化投入了大量的精力。2世纪 8年代以来, O 0关系系统逐渐代替网状系统和层次系统而占领了市场。实践证明,由于关系模型具有严格的数学基础,概念清晰简单,数据独立性强,支持商在业数据处理的应用上非常成功。但是,系模型不能用一张表模型表示关出复杂对象的语义,不擅长于数据类型较多、复杂的领域。随着多媒较体应用的扩大,对数据库提出了新的需求,要求数据库系统能存储和处理图形、图像、声音等复杂的对象,并能实现复杂对象的复杂行为。在这种需求的驱动下,数据库模型又进入了新的研究阶段——面向对象数据库技术的研究。 2 0世纪 8 0年代中期以来,面向对象数据库系统”0 DB )“对“ (O S ̄I对象关系数据库系统” R B )究都十分活跃。18年和 19先后 ( D S的研 O 99 90发表了《面向对象数据库系统宣言》第三代数据库系统宣言》和《。面向 对象数据库系统是指支持面向对象特性的数据库,它提供了面向对象的建模方法、编程语言和数据库语言,支持正文、图像、图形、音等新声的数据类型,支持类、继承、函数,方法等丰富的对象机制,能提供高并度集成的、可支持客户机/服役器应用的用户接口。1 8 9 9年在东京举行了关于面向对象数据库的国际会议,第一次定义了面向对象数据库管理系统所应实现的功能:支持复杂对象、支持对象标识、允许对象封装、 支持类型或类、支持继承、免过早绑定、避计算性完整、可扩充、能记住数据位置、能管理非常大型的数据库、接收并发用户、能从软硬件失效中
恢复、用简单的方法支持数据查询。有一些厂商已推出了具有对象关系数据库特征的产品, rce O al就是其中之一,具有查询对象关系能力的新一代数据库语言标准 S L已经历了 S L 9 S 20 S L 0 5等阶 Q Q 9、QL 00、Q 2 0段,它的完善标志着数据库技术的进步和成熟,数据库操纵功能已溶入
事物处理环境上的。随着技术的进步,人们试图让计算机担任更多的工作,而数据库技术也一直力图使自己能胜任从事务处理、批处理到分析处理的各种的信息处理任务。后来人们逐渐认识到,目前的计算机处在理能力上,根本 …… 此处隐藏:2470字,全部文档内容请下载后查看。喜欢就下载吧 ……
下一篇:安全监理实施细则